Output 03a9ec51ee1874bee6899e043f08db666dc635c3dc41fd933bb2bdde377bf9a3:36

value
664659100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aa98ea597c6115a530cbfe70a19a6231fc9de0b OP_EQUAL
address
MBnjjXdJ4NmdAmM7nWRyyivCTQWkBXFqwb
transaction
03a9ec51ee1874bee6899e043f08db666dc635c3dc41fd933bb2bdde377bf9a3
spent
true